This is an OCR edition with typos. Excerpt from book: CHAPTER III A TRAGEDY IX THE GRASS. Next came a cockchafer, big, heavy, and rough-footed, tumbling about like a comfortable citizen who has stayed too long at the public- house, and is going home a good deal too late, and pretty well scared at being alone. He took long steps but did not get on much, for he was blinded by the sunlight, and his great tail dragged in the sand. At first sight one would have thought that he had been feasting too deeply on the branches of the old Pear-Tree, and that some drops of dew had disturbed his brain. Yet this idea would have been very incorrect; for in truth the poor creature was only dazzled, and certainly so might any one have been in his place, for he had just made his entrance into the world. Four years before, on a fine June evening, his mother had dug a trench in the ground at the foot of the great tree, and laid some oblong eggs in it of a pale yellow colour. When she had satisfactorily accomplished this, returning above ground she inhaled the balmy breaths of air in a melancholy mood; and after having spent a few days on a leafy branch, at last fell from it and died amid the stalks of a forget-me-not. She had laid her eggs side by side; and as time went by, and they felt the reviving influences of spring, they gradually changed their colour. At last thence issued certain six-footed white larvae, and among them our cockchafer, then only a humble worm?a kind of false caterpillar with five rings. His head was scaly, hard, and rather brown; there were two great eyes in it, and it had strong jaws, finished off by a pair of short antennae. Almost with his first breath of life began sharp twinges in the region of the stomach, and he set ravenously to work, with a fierce burning, insatiable appetite. He grew and changed his ...

Book excerpt: Since the early nineteenth century, when entomologists first popularized the unique biological and behavioral characteristics of insects, technological innovators and theorists have proposed insects as templates for a wide range of technologies. In Insect Media, Jussi Parikka analyzes how insect forms of social organization-swarms, hives, webs, and distributed intelligence-have been used to structure modern media technologies and the network society, providing a radical new perspective on the interconnection of biology and technology. Through close engagement with the pioneering work of insect ethologists, including Jakob von Uexküll and Karl von Frisch, posthumanist philosophers, media theorists, and contemporary filmmakers and artists, Parikka develops an insect theory of media, one that conceptualizes modern media as more than the products of individual human actors, social interests, or technological determinants. They are, rather, profoundly nonhuman phenomena that both draw on and mimic the alien lifeworlds of insects. Deftly moving from the life sciences to digital technology, from popular culture to avant-garde art and architecture, and from philosophy to cybernetics and game theory, Parikka provides innovative conceptual tools for exploring the phenomena of network society and culture. Challenging anthropocentric approaches to contemporary science and culture, Insect Media reveals the possibilities that insects and other nonhuman animals offer for rethinking media, the conflation of biology and technology, and our understanding of, and interaction with, contemporary digital culture.

Book excerpt: Though popular opinion would have us see Alice’s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king Glass and What Alice Found There as whimsical, nonsensical, and thoroughly enjoyable stories told mostly for children; contemporary research has shown us there is a vastly greater depth to the stories than would been seen at first glance. Building on the now popular idea amongst Alice enthusiasts, that the Alice books - at heart - were intended for adults as well as children, Laura White takes current research in a new, fascinating direction. During the Victorian era of the book’s original publication, ideas about nature and our relation to nature were changing drastically. The Alice Books and the Contested Ground of the Natural World argues that Lewis Carroll used the book’s charm, wit, and often puzzling conclusions to counter the emerging tendencies of the time which favored Darwinism and theories of evolution and challenged the then-conventional thinking of the relationship between mankind and nature. Though a scientist and ardent student of nature himself, Carroll used his famously playful language, fantastic worlds and brilliant, often impossible characters to support more the traditional, Christian ideology of the time in which mankind holds absolute sovereignty over animals and nature.
